Abstract: | The method of sliding direction fitting is used to determine stress districts, taking the shear stress directions and ratios
of shear stress to stress on fault planes given by focal mechanism solutions as the criteria to select focal mechanism solutions
of one region and sorting out the earthquakes controlled by different tectonic stress fields, and then determining the stress
districts from epicenter distribution of earthquakes. We call this method as step by step convergence method. By inversion
analyzing of 297 focal mechanism solutions, we consider that Southwest China and its adjacent area can be divided into 5 stress
districts, and we worked out directions of the three principal stresses and values of shape factor φ in 5 stress districts.
